Chapter 10. Figure 1. Dual hybridization probe (HybProbe) technology for SNP genotyping. Two probes, each with one fluorophore are designed to hybridize next to each other on the target so that they are in resonance energy transfer. One probe is blocked at the 3'-end and hybridizes to invariant sequence (anchor probe) while the other hybridizes over the variable locus (sensor probe). After PCR, the solution is heated and fluorescence monitored. A melting curve for a heterozygote is shown, along with the corresponding negative derivative plot.
